The buffs went crazy when Sanjay Leela Bhansali announced his movie titled Inshallah with Salman Khan. The movie was supposed to feature Salman Khan and Alia Bhatt working together for the first time. But the movie got shelved within few days of announcement.

Recently, while having an interaction with Bollywood Hungama, the topic of Inshallah was raised and Bhansali was asked about his plans to work with Salman. The filmmaker acknowledged that there are differences but the actor is still a close friend.

He said, "Salman is a very dear friend, and I wanted to work with him after Padmavat. I put my best feet forward to make it happen. For whatever reasons, it didn't turn out. We all change as people. So he has changed; in his mind, I have changed."

However, Salman and Bhansali worked together for the first time back in Hum Dil De Chuke Sanam. The movie captured Aishwarya Rai Bachchan and Ajay Devgan in pivotal roles.

Sanjay Leela Bhansali's recent release Gangubai Kathiawadi starring Alia Bhatt in the lead role has breathed new life into theatres.
